Output 88e1ec34482038b0aa8e80c9f06c64403100eb5e19c0fad13aa74181020ad47d:91

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dd51fef1dc154dab74f40165964fce36b1ea4da3476a92dc96fc1f07e19cd20
address
bc1phh23lmcac92d4d60gqt9je8uud43afx6x3m2jtwfdlqlqlsee5sqpfmr6u
transaction
88e1ec34482038b0aa8e80c9f06c64403100eb5e19c0fad13aa74181020ad47d
spent
true